Wood Siding Replacement in Brighton, CO
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ged or aging wood siding and installing new panels to restore the appearance and integrity of a property's exterior. These projects typically address issues such as rotting, warping, insect damage, or weather-related wear, helping to protect the underlying structure and improve curb appeal. Homeowners often seek this service when their existing siding no longer provides adequate protection or aesthetic appeal, and they want to ensure their home remains well-maintained and visually appealing.
Before requesting wood siding replacement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the work involved, including whether the existing siding needs complete removal or if partial repairs are possible. It’s also common to inquire about the types of wood available, the durability of different options, and how the new siding will match or complement the existing exterior. Clarifying these details helps ensure the replacement process aligns with the property's needs and the homeowner’s aesthetic preferences.

Wood Siding Replacement Questions
What types of wood siding can be replaced? Common options include cedar, pine, and redwood siding, which can be matched to existing materials or upgraded for improved durability.
How is the replacement process typically performed? The process involves removing damaged siding, preparing the surface, and installing new panels to ensure a proper fit and finish.
What signs indicate wood siding needs replacement? Signs include rotting, warping, cracking, or extensive pest damage that cannot be repaired effectively.
Are there different styles of wood siding available for replacement? Yes, options include lap siding, shingles, and board-and-batten styles to complement various architectural designs.
